Han Wei, Chief Engineer, CT
Wei Han is the Chief Engineer of Communications Technologies and leads the Medium Access Control and Intelligent Solution (MACI) team. Her research focuses on 5G NR base station protocol stack development, system integration and verification, end-to-end testing, user case and application development, lab tests and trials, customer engagement, and supporting commercialisation of 5G NR technologies. She joined ASTRI after completing her PhD studies in Electronic Engineering at The Chinese University of Hong Kong in 2006.
Q. Can you share some of your proudest moments at ASTRI?
I felt proud when our customer, Sunnada, using base stations with ASTRI technology inside them (base station PHY layer design), passed the CMCC tender test, ranking #1 in 2015 and #5 in 2018, which enabled the wide deployment of their base stations in Chinese cities, such as Beijing, Shanghai and Fuzhou.
I also felt proud when I was one of the representatives from COM to attend the Geneva Award celebration in 2021. The awards meant that ASTRI technologies are highly recognized by the international community.
Q. What was your motivation for getting into this field of research?
My motivation was to make our R&D results become end products that could be deployed worldwide.
As the PC of ARD/256 (5G NR O-RAN for Configurable Network Deployment), I led the project team to study 5G NR O-RAN architecture, protocols and software-hardware integration, set up a proof-of-concept 5G NR O-RAN system, and conducted end-to-end tests to prove that the 5G NR O-RAN concept was feasible. This know-how and experience with 5G NR O-RAN served as a solid foundation for ASTRI 5G NR O-RAN technologies development, which led to the ITF platform project of the 5G O-RAN Base Station, which will be launched soon. There will also be a series of PRPs to commercialize ASTRI 5G NR O-RAN technologies in customers’ end products (such as 5G base stations and O-RAN commercial software) for deployment.
